What is Boyle's Law?
Back
Boyle's Law states that the pressure of a gas is inversely proportional to its volume when the temperature is held constant. This means that as the volume of a gas decreases, its pressure increases, and vice versa.

What is Charles' Law?
Back
Charles' Law states that the volume of a gas is directly proportional to its temperature (in Kelvin) when the pressure is held constant. This means that as the temperature of a gas increases, its volume also increases.
